Transaction e002233bf3403a968aaffbbbcb3fd3dce73bbdccc4732c431db0882390fc9c5e

1 Input
2 Outputs
  • e002233bf3403a968aaffbbbcb3fd3dce73bbdccc4732c431db0882390fc9c5e:0
  • value  3500000
    address  16SpPbdSTYSUGpa7vYBxtgwCBjx5YLPKPc
  • e002233bf3403a968aaffbbbcb3fd3dce73bbdccc4732c431db0882390fc9c5e:1
  • value  35919240
    address  37xCe9v8imWtkmdZafYG4cpWKfyggpA62U